Chapel Gallery Information for Artists
and
Interested Others
This is our Church's mission
statement, and artists should be mindful of it when submitting works
for
possible display in the Chapel Gallery. Artists
wishing to exhibit their works in the Chapel Gallery should submit
either
reproductions or slides of their art works to the MSUMC Committee on
Ministries
to the City and the Arts for consideration. They should also submit a
one-page
description of why the exhibit of their art works is particularly
appropriate
for the Chapel Gallery. (For example, we do not typically exhibit nude
subject
matter.) The submission of a resume is optional. Submission dates are March 1
and September 1. At the request of the Committee, artists may be asked
to meet
with the Committee with samples of their works. Artists will be notified in
writing by the Committee of acceptance of their art works for exhibit
in the
Chapel Gallery. Schedules for exhibition hanging, opening, and closing
will be
arranged jointly by the artist and the Committee. If the art work is to be
sold, the Church will cooperate with the artist to post the prices and
the
names of the pieces. All money from sales goes to the artist. Donations
to the
Church will be gratefully accepted. Thank you for
considering the
Chapel Gallery as an exhibition space for your art work. We hope that
both our
needs and yours can be satisfied in a fruitful partnership. May the
grace of
God be with you!
